Mastering the Art of Timing and Prediction
At its heart, success in navigating the digital roadways with your feathered friend hinges on a keen understanding of timing and prediction. It’s not enough to simply react to the vehicles as they approach; a proficient player anticipates their movements, judging their speed and trajectory to identify safe windows for crossing. This requires a constant assessment of the road situation, factoring in the varying speeds of different vehicles and the gaps between them. Initially, players may rely on quick reflexes, but as they progress, they'll find that a more proactive approach – predicting where the cars will be rather than merely responding to where they are – yields far more consistent results. Recognizing patterns in traffic flow becomes crucial for high-score attempts.
Developing a Rhythm and Consistent Strategy
One of the most effective techniques for mastering the timing aspect of this game is to develop a rhythm. Players often find themselves subconsciously timing their movements to the flow of traffic, creating a consistent pattern for crossing. This rhythm allows for more predictable and controlled movements, reducing the likelihood of impulsive decisions that could lead to a collision. Alongside rhythm, a consistent strategy is important. Determining whether to attempt shorter, more frequent crossings or to patiently wait for larger gaps can dramatically impact your score. Experimenting with these approaches to find one that suits your playstyle is key. Learning to recognize ‘safe zones’ within the traffic pattern is also a useful skill.

The Role of Reflexes and Hand-Eye Coordination
While timing and prediction form the strategic foundation, quick reflexes and sharp hand-eye coordination are essential for executing successful crossings. Even with perfect anticipation, unexpected events can occur – a sudden increase in speed, a vehicle swerving unexpectedly – requiring immediate and precise responses. The game demands rapid decision-making and precise input, testing your ability to translate visual information into swift physical actions. This element of reactive gameplay adds an extra layer of challenge and excitement, making each attempt feel unique and engaging. Improving your hand-eye coordination doesn't just benefit your gameplay; it's a valuable skill that can enhance performance in many other areas.
Exercises to Improve Reflexes
For players looking to hone their reflexes, several exercises can prove beneficial. Simple reaction time tests, available online, can help you measure and track your improvement. Practicing other fast-paced games that require quick decisions and precise movements, such as platformers or shooters, can also indirectly enhance your reflexes. Focusing on maintaining a relaxed grip on the input device (whether it’s a mouse, keyboard, or touchscreen) can also improve responsiveness. Tense muscles tend to slow down reactions. Regular breaks are also crucial; fatigue can significantly impair reflexes.

The Psychology of Risk and Reward
The compelling nature of the chicken road game isn't solely about mechanical skill; it's also deeply rooted in the psychology of risk and reward. Each crossing represents a calculated risk – the potential for a high score is balanced against the possibility of a game over. This creates a constant internal debate, encouraging players to push their limits while remaining mindful of the consequences. The thrill of successfully navigating a particularly dangerous stretch of road is amplified by the knowledge that a single misstep could end it all. This dynamic interplay between risk and reward is what keeps players coming back for more, seeking that exhilarating feeling of triumph. The game leverages our innate desire for accomplishment.
The Dopamine Loop and Addictive Gameplay
The consistent stream of small rewards – successful crossings, incremental score increases – triggers the release of dopamine in the brain, creating a positive feedback loop. This dopamine rush reinforces the behavior, making players more likely to repeat it. It’s a core principle behind the addictive nature of many games, and the chicken road game is no exception. However, understanding this mechanism can help players manage their gameplay habits and avoid excessive playing. Recognizing that the enjoyment comes from the dopamine release, rather than the game itself, can allow a more mindful approach.

Variations and Evolution of the Core Concept
The original concept of the chicken road game has spawned numerous variations and adaptations, each adding its own unique twist to the core formula. Some versions introduce different characters with varying speeds or abilities, while others incorporate obstacles beyond just traffic, such as moving platforms or environmental hazards. Many iterations also feature power-ups that grant temporary advantages, such as invincibility or increased speed. These variations not only enhance the replay value but also demonstrate the versatility of the underlying gameplay mechanics. Developers continue to innovate within this framework, constantly refining and expanding upon the original idea.
The evolution of the game reflects a broader trend in game design – the ability to take a simple concept and build upon it with creative additions and modifications. This iterative process is driven by player feedback and a desire to continually improve the gaming experience. The successful variations often retain the core elements that made the original so appealing – the challenging gameplay, the rewarding progression, and the sense of risk and reward – while introducing new layers of complexity and excitement.
